Banjara Hills Hyderabad sits at ₹15k–25k / sqft, with apartment buy median around ₹2.8 Cr and apartment rent median around ₹70,000 / month (calibrated against 99acres + broker price index 2025, 2025). Hyperlocal rates Banjara Hills as moderate conviction on the investor lens (7–10 year horizon). The strongest driver: Legacy premium — rare liquidity events but ticket holds value. The flag we are watching: Yield 2.2–2.8% — capital parking, not cash flow. Open the investor lens on the map for the full driver / risk breakdown and yield comparison.
